Halloween Mod Contest '22
I know, I know. It's a little late. But I think everyone can agree that this is a fun holiday to celebrate, we get really creative submissions, and everyone that would normally participate is probably already working on something with or without the contest, so let's do this.

Halloween contests are all about making spooky mods for Jedi Outcast or Jedi Academy. Think about monsters, goblins, & ghouls. Vampires, zombies, & ghosts. Having a Star Wars twist is always a bonus, in my opinion. You can make maps, playermodels, skins, cosmetic mods, etc. If it goes in a PK3, it's fair game.

Rules:

All submissions must be Halloween-themed (so scary, spooky, frightening, etc. 👻)


You can only enter your own creations.


You may enter more than one file.


Already existing files cannot be submitted. The goal is to encourage new creations!


Any mod content is welcome, including skins, models, maps, weapons, menu mods, etc. Just make sure it abides by the rules.


Files can be for Jedi Academy and/or Jedi Outcast. We will assume files are for JKA unless specified otherwise.


The deadline for submitting content is October 27, 2022, after which a poll will be opened.


The poll will be closed by the morning of October 31, 2022.

Banner Artwork Contest
Hey folks, a new contest has been long overdue, I know. I meant to start this one up shortly after the last one but too many things took my attention away. I have way too many hobbies to keep up with. 😅 No summer themed contest this year, but that could be up to you depending on your submission.

Everyone likes mod contests but sometimes it’s fun to mix it up and try something different. We have a decent number of in-game photographers, digital artists, and lots of creative people that could make this one really cool.

Essentially this is a contest for who can make the best Jedi Knight-related poster/banner for JKHub. I’ve been wanting something really nice and flashy looking to use for the front page and for social media accounts, and I made one really quick back when we launched the new theme. I can probably spend a lot more time on making a better one, but I figured it would be much better to involve the community.

This isn’t just to win and get the award badge on your profile. This will be the new banner on the front page of JKHub in place of the existing one and will be used on social media.

So what qualifies as a banner?

An image in PNG or PSD format.
Dimensions at minimum 3200px X 2000px with 72ppi
Aspect ratio of 16:10.
If you include text, you must also include a textless version.
If you include a signature, make it unobtrusive but still legible.
Must be related to the Jedi Knight series (particularly Outcast & Academy), including characters, locations, weapons, items, etc.
Multiple entries are allowed.
Additional orientations are allowed, but a horizontal 16:10 is required.
Upload in a ZIP file to ensure no unnecessary compression is added anywhere.
No pornographic or ultra violent subjects or content allowed.
Huge bonus points if you make a version for each major season of the year or holidays.
By submitting to this contest, you are fully aware that your art will be used by us, for JKHub. Full credit to you will be given when and where possible.

Jedi Academy: Enhanced new version released
Jedi Academy: Enhanced is a mod for Jedi Academy Single Player which adds features and improvements to the core experience of the base game like RGB sabers, saber customization, saber holstering, new force powers, and much more.

This is for new or old players who want to play through the single player story of Jedi Academy with some enhancements and new features without completely overhauling the core vision of the game.

Credit goes to redsaurus who has single-handedly put in tons of code work and implementation, as well as the creators of the other content like Kahn's UltimateWeapons, Ashura's DL-44, Plasma's lightsabers, therfiles' camSP, and more (mentioned in readme and file page).

Obi-Wan Kenobi (Exiled)
After the poster and trailer reveal of Obi-Wan Kenobi, I wanted to kit together his new exiled look. I like what they did with his hair and all, so I tried to replicate it as close as possible!

----------------------------------------------

Install Instructions: Put the "ZZ-Kenobi_Exile.pk3" inside your base folder.
Uninstall Instructions: Remove the "ZZ-Kenobi_Exile.pk3" from your base folder.

----------------------------------------------

Features:

Sounds: Yes
NPC Support: Yes
BOT Support: No

----------------------------------------------

To use the models, type these into your command console (or select the Icons in the player select screen):

"/model Obiwan_Exile" (his default attire)

"/model Obiwan_Exile/hood" (for his hood up)

To spawn him as an NPC, type these commands into your console:

"/npc spawn Obiwan_Exile" (his default attire)

"/npc spawn Obiwan_Exile_hood" (for his hood up)

----------------------------------------------

External Content Used / Credits:

Sirius-- Used Malicos parts (the hair)
Star Wars: Force Arena-- Luke Skywalker, Tatooine robes
MD2 Team-- Obi-Wan head model & Textures

Jedi Outcast 20th Anniversary Developer Retrospective
It's been 20 years since Jedi Outcast launched in 2002, if you can believe that. This masterpiece of a game truly defined what it means to be Jedi in a video game, even to this day, with its intricate lightsaber combat and Force powers. Continuing the Dark Forces story, Outcast follows the mercenary turned Jedi, Kyle Katarn, after he shuts himself off from the Force and returns to being an agent of the New Republic.

With such a milestone anniversary, I really wanted to do something special here, and unfortunately I did not get this published in time for the actual day, yesterday. I'm hoping I will be forgiven for being late with how great this project turned out.

I got a chance to sit down with 5 of the developers of Jedi Outcast over a Zoom call and not only did they take time to talk with me about this wonderful game, but they talked to me for nearly 3 hours. I cut it down to just 2 hours. It's clear from the very beginning that they were truly passionate about this game and consider it their proudest achievement. Take a look at the video below and listen as they reminisce and chat about development and that era of their careers!

Jedi Starfighter Racing Map
Map made by Gnost

Basically this is a huge spaceship racing map that allow max 6 players to spawn a jedi starfighter and race with it.

It has 2 different circuits, a short (1min) and a long one (2min) that can be changed through a button.

Supports FFA/TFFA modes.

 

Known bugs: Sometimes after using a spaceship, player movement seems bugged. It can be fixed by using a spaceship again or just do /reconnect.
